About this Property
Indulge in Unique Decor
Experience the charm of individually decorated rooms at Burnside B&B, adorned with William Morris prints and Tiffany lamps, offering a cozy retreat with non-allergy bedding.
Culinary Delights Await
Start your day with a delectable breakfast selection, from home-made waffles to traditional full English, or opt for gluten-free and vegan options. Savor your meal by the wood-burning stove for a truly relaxing morning.
